Cellular Transport
Cellular transports demote to the movement of compounds across the outer wall or membrane of the cell. This transport is critical in two respects. Firstly, transport permits a cell to take in and release compounds in accordance along with its biological function (for instance, the uptake and let go of oxygen through red blood cells). Secondly, it permits cells to regulate features of this transport (for instance, increased transport of glucose within muscle cells during activity).
